Oakland Community College will celebrate the opening of their new Culinary Studies Institute next week at the Royal Oak Campus.
An opening will be held from 4-7 p.m. on Friday, Oct. 17 to introduce their new $74 million, three-story expansion.
The brand-new 78,000 square-foot facility features three classrooms, two demonstration kitchens and five teaching kitchens.
“This facility makes us more competitive. We have the premier culinary teaching facility in Michigan. It’s cutting-edge and truly reflects the talent of our faculty and students,” said Doug Ganhs, culinary department chairman and instructor. “To have the best of the best equipment, all the bells and whistles, really allows us to show students where the industry is headed and the wave of the future.”
